Original Description
Johan Severin Nilsson’s Skordearbete ("Harvest Work") is a captivating depiction of rural labor, exuding a serene yet industrious energy characteristic of 19th-century Scandinavian realism. The painting showcases agricultural workers immersed in golden fields, bathed in soft natural light that highlights Nilsson’s meticulous attention to texture—whether the swaying grain or the weathered faces of laborers. Created during a period when Nordic artists embraced national romanticism and social realism, Nilsson’s work reflects both admiration for peasant life and subtle commentary on its hardships. While lesser-known internationally, his contributions align with contemporaries like Carl Larsson, celebrating agrarian traditions while grounding them in palpable realism. Skordearbete occupies a nuanced space in art history, bridging idyllic pastoralism with unvarnished authenticity.
